The Impact of Cognitive Biases on Slot Video Game Decision-Making



Several players commonly undervalue the influence of cognitive prejudices and make spontaneous choices when playing Slot video games. These prejudices, rooted in our believing patterns and mental faster ways, can greatly affect our decision-making process.

Below are 4 cognitive biases that commonly come into play when playing Slot video games:

1. Accessibility Bias: This predisposition triggers players to overestimate the probability of winning based on current success or near misses. They might think that a win is a lot more impending due to the fact that they bear in mind previous wins strongly.

2. Bettor's Misconception: This predisposition leads players to think that previous end results can influence future outcomes. As an example, if a gamer has been losing for a while, they might begin to believe that a win is due quickly, even though each spin is independent of previous spins.

3. Anchoring Bias: This bias takes place when players fixate on a details result or number and base their choices on it. For example, if a player sees a big prize marketed, they may become a lot more willing to spend even more money in pursuit of that certain outcome.

4. Confirmation Prejudice: This bias causes players to seek information that verifies their existing beliefs and disregard or disregard information that contradicts them.
